Excerpt
1 Unto thee will I cry, O Lord my rock; be not silent to me: lest, if thou be silent to me, I become like them that go down into the pit . 2 Hear the voice of my supplications, when I cry unto thee, when I lift up my hands toward thy holy oracle . 3 Draw me not away with the wicked, and with the workers of iniquity, which speak peace to their neighbours, but mischief is in their hearts. 4 Give them according to their deeds , and according to the wickedness of their endeavours: give them after the work of their hands; render to them their desert . 5 Because they regard not the works of the Lord , nor the operation of his hands, he shall destroy them, and not build them up. 6 Blessed be the Lord , because he hath heard the voice of my supplications. 7 The Lord is my strength and my shield; my heart trusted in him, and I am helped: therefore my heart greatly rejoiceth; and with my song will I praise him. 8 The Lord is their strength, and he is the saving strength of his anointed. 9 Save thy people, and bless thine inheritance: feed them also, and lift them up for ever.
